Elbridge Andrew Colby is an American national security policy professional who is the under secretary of defense for policy since April 9, 2025. He previously served as deputy assistant secretary of defense for strategy and force development from 2017 to 2018 during the first Trump administration. He played a key role in the development of the 2018 U.S. National Defense Strategy, which, among other things, shifted the U.S. Defense Department's focus to China. He is also the grandson of former CIA director William Colby.
